Abstract

In this study, we introduce a new concept by making Possibility Fermatean fuzzy soft sets into a more general concept, namely Intuitionistic Possibility Fermatean fuzzy soft sets. We present examples of the application of this theory to a decision-making problem. From a theoretical point of view, we review the basic properties of this model and define the operations essential to its framework. Comprehensive definitions of complement, union, and intersection, as well as AND and OR operations are meticulously presented. As a transition from theory to practical application within this innovative context, we present an algorithm for solving decision-making problems, contributing to the practical implementation of this extended concept. This research aims to improve our understanding of the intuitionistic possibility of Fermatean fuzzy soft sets and to bridge the gap between theoretical advances and their real-world utility in decision-making problems.
